- Course Description
This course is an examination into the nature of an American society as an articulation of democracy. Making use of The Wire as a visual text alongside the research from various fields found in academic articles, this course seeks to challenge students in creating questions and posing questions on what makes and ought to make an American city function. The intent of class lectures, discussions, viewing, reading assignments, and writing activities are to foster within students a sense of the need for, and role of, critical thinking in addressing societal issues as the responsibility of a just democracy.
